In Brief
The Commissioner of Income Tax (Delhi) sought a special leave petition challenging a High Court judgment in a case against Monoflex India. The Supreme Court found that the directions issued by the High Court had already been complied with by the parties. Consequently, the Court dismissed the special leave petition while leaving the underlying question of law open for future consideration. All pending applications were disposed of. The judgment emphasizes that where substantive compliance has already occurred, the petition may be dismissed without deciding the legal question on merits.">
